**Q: The new turnstiles in the Marlow House lobby won't read the old laminated passes. What do assistants need to know?**

A: As of this week, the upgraded Gatewell turnstiles accept only chip-enabled badges. Legacy laminated passes stopped working when the old barriers were decommissioned. If a team member is locked out, walk them to the side gate by the mailroom, which stays on the keypad system until everyone has been re-badged. The keypad accepts the interim entry code below.

door code, yagap-bahof: bdg-O-05

**Mgmt Meeting Minutes — Retiring the Brightline Range**

Quick recap for sales leads at Fenholt Supplies: we agreed to retire the Brightline fixture range by year-end. Remaining stock moves to clearance pricing next month, and accounts on standing orders get migrated to the Lumetta range. Trade-in incentives were approved in principle. The confidential note on next steps sits just below.

board note of bajof-bajeg: The pricing group signed off on a budget of $13.4 million for Project Sildor. The renewal with Lamixek Holdings closes at $48.9 million a year, 49 percent above the last contract.

Subject: Scheduled key rotation — Linkweave deep-link router

Hi on-call,

Per our quarterly policy, we are rotating the credential used by the Linkweave deep-link routing service tonight at 22:00. During the cutover window, mobile deep links may briefly fall back to web URLs; this is expected and should self-resolve within two minutes. Please monitor the routing dashboard for elevated fallback rates afterward and escalate if they persist past 22:15. For your reference during the window, the new key is below.

gateway credential: kto23_LX9A4ys6i4nzHtpOLNLodKK

Prepared for the incoming director of operations at Fenwright Industrial. Our sole supplier of polymer housings, Calderon Moldworks, represents a single point of failure for the Vantage line. Procurement has shortlisted three candidates: two in the Ostermere corridor, one near Port Halvane. Qualification samples are due within six weeks; dual-sourcing should reduce unit risk without raising costs more than 4%. The board has asked that this effort align with the confidential direction noted below.

confidential, kagup-bafog: Fraaxax Group is in early talks to buy Soroxox Group for about $343.8 million. The Olidor launch date is June 14, and nothing goes to the press before then. Legal wants the Aldmirek Logistics term sheet signed before July 23.